Your favourite family and ours, The Dingles, will star in the first ever feature-length Emmerdale made for DVD.

Two parallel worlds collide in the one-off special: Dingles For Richer For Poorer, featuring Zak, Lisa, Sam, Belle, Samson, Cain, Marlon, Chas, Charity and Noah. Jimmy and Nicola King will also appear.

And here's the story... The Dingles are feeling the pinch, resorting to eating scraps and selling old bric-a-brac to make ends meet. Clutching at straws, Zak and Belle go to buy a Eurobillions rollover week ticket.

As Zak and Belle head off, we enter two parallel universes and the fun enfolds as fate serves up very different futures from their lucky numbers.

Will it be the reality of winning the lottery that brings delight, or will the harsher reality of lies and bogus tickets leave the clan counting the cost of nearly winning a fortune?

The havoc unfolds with hilarious results as the film asks the question: ‘How much would winning the lottery change you?’

Dingles For Richer For Poorer will be available on DVD and to download from the 15th November.

HUGE January storyline...

Tragedy strikes in the Dales this January when a raging inferno rips through the village, leaving a trail of destruction and heartbreak in its wake which not everyone will survive.


Terrified locals watch in horror as the ferocious fire engulfs a row of cottages in the heart of the village and threatens the lives of some of the show’s best-loved characters.


The shock blaze will see at least two villagers perish, but viewers will be kept waiting until the explosive episode airs to find out who makes it out alive.


Betty (Paula Tilbrook) is left fighting for her life when the fire spreads to Keepers Cottage, but will she survive the fumes? As Victoria Cottage catches light, house-mates Chas (Lucy Pargeter) and Gennie (Sian Reese-Williams) are left in peril, could they meet their fate in the flames? Or will Katie (Sammy Winward) be doomed after arguing with her angry ex Andy who has a history of arson.


Brenda (Lesley Dunlop) and Terry (Billy Hartman) could be in danger when their home is caught up in the inferno. While Viv (Deena Payne) is alone in the flat drowning her sorrows after Terry has rejected her advances. Will she get out before it’s too late and the building is consumed by the blaze?


Lives will be lost and families will be destroyed in some of the show’s most spectacular scenes ever. As the villagers mourn the loss of their neighbours they’re horrified to learn that this was no accident. How long can the arsonist hide their guilt before their web of lies spirals out of control?


Series Producer Gavin Blyth said: “This is going to be one of the most dramatic and tragic events ever to rock Emmerdale and no-one will be untouched by the fire’s devastating consequences. The whole village will be thrown together for these gripping and heart-wrenching episodes which will launch us into an unmissable 2011.”


The explosive episodes will air in mid-January 2011.
